Audi A8 (4E) Rear Camera

Coding
▪ ?0x0xxx: Manufacturer
▪ 1 = Audi
▪ x0?0xxx: Trailer & Parking System
▪ +1 = Trailer Hitch installed
▪ +2 = Optical Parking System installed
▪ x0x0?xx: Camera Height
▪ 0 = Camera Height 1
▪ 1 = Camera Height 2
▪ 2 = Camera Height 3
▪ 3 = Camera Height 4
▪ 4 = Camera Height 5
▪ 5 = Camera Height 6
▪ 6 = Camera Height 7
▪ 7 = Camera Height 8
▪ x0x0x??: Model
▪ 01 = Audi Q7 (4L)
▪ 02 = Audi A8 (4E) Short Wheel Base
▪ 03 = Audi A8 (4E) Long Wheel Base
▪ 04 = Audi A6 (4F) Sedan / Rest of World (RoW)
▪ 05 = Audi A6 (4F) Wagon/Avant
▪ 06 = Audi A4 (8K) Sedan
▪ 08 = Audi A5 (8T) Coupé
▪ 12 = Audi R8 (42)
▪ 14 = Audi A6 (4F) Sedan / China (CHN)

Camera Calibration
After performing service work, the calibration has to be performed too.
e.g.:
▪ Removing and Installing Rear View Camera (R189)
▪ Replacing Rear View Camera System Control Module (J772)
▪ after repair work performed on rear lid following an accident
▪ after a vehicle alignment
▪ after performing a repair at front or rear axle

Prerequisites:
▪ Calibration Device (VAS 6350) and Distance Laser (VAS 6350/2) positioned as described in the factory repair manual.
▪ Vehicle must be standing on a firm and even surface.
▪ Tape measure
▪ Do not move the vehicle and do not operate the vehicle doors while performing the calibration.
▪ Rear Lid must be closed.
▪ Front Wheels straight, Steering Angle Sensor (G85) close to 0.0 ° in Measuring blocks 005.
▪ Ignition must be ON, Engine must NOT be running, you may connect a charger to keep the system voltage up.
▪ Back-Up Camera active and the MMI shows Back-Up Camera Video Signal.
▪ Make sure you do NOT have light reflections on the Calibration Device (VAS 6350).
▪ On vehicle vehicle’s suspension Level Control, set the Height to automatic.

[Select]
[6C - Back-Up Camera]
[Security Access - 16]
Enter 22351, to enable the adaptation.

[Adaptation - 10]
Channel 005
[Read]
500 mm is the basis value of channel 005. Measure the heights between the Calibration Device (VAS 6350) and the ground surface
(e.g. 80 mm for OE, 4mm for cardboard), add 500 mm to it and enter the final value as new value (e.g. 500 + 4 = 504 mm).
[Test]
[Save]

Channel 004
[Read]
20000 mm is the basis value of channel 004, 2944mm (wheelbase for Audi A8 SWB (4E) or 3074 mm (wheelbase for Audi A8L (4E)).
Measure the Distance between the Calibration Device (VAS 6350) and the rear axle (e.g. 1500 mm), and subtract it from 20000 mm minus 3074 mm
enter the final value as new value (e.g. 20000 - 3074 - 1500 = 15426 mm).
[Test]
[Save]

Channel 001
[Read]
To save your above adaptation save a new value of 1 to channel 001.
[Test]
[Save]
The screen will go black now and it will now take several minutes to calibrate - read on how to see progress...
[Done, Go Back]

Now watch the calibration status.
[Meas. Blocks - 08]
Block 130
[Go!]
Block 130 Field 3 (Calibration Status)
See popup for what each code means.
Specification: 0x0000 (Calibration Successful)
[Done, Go Back]
[Close Controller, Go Back - 06]
